Linux服务器安装MySQL 8.0.18教程:从下载到配置

4 下载量 180 浏览量 更新于2024-09-04 收藏 717KB PDF 举报
本文主要介绍了如何在Linux系统上安装MySQL 8.0.18版本。以下是详细步骤: 1. **下载MySQL for Linux**: 首先,从提供的云盘链接(链接:<https://pan.baidu.com/s/1Vyl_UQfYBaWa0vkki2_C0Q>,提取码:0kip)下载Linux版本的MySQL 8.0.18安装包。通常情况下,下载的是`.tar.xz`格式的压缩文件,如`mysql-8.0.18-linux-glibc2.12-x86_64.tar.xz`。 2. **上传到Linux服务器**: 使用rz命令将下载的文件上传到Linux服务器。如果系统尚未安装lrzsz工具,可以通过`yum install -y lrzsz`来安装。 3. **解压文件**: 在服务器上使用`tar -xvf mysql-8.0.18-linux-glibc2.12-x86_64.tar.xz`解压下载的文件。解压后,将文件移动到`/usr/local`目录下,并重命名为`mysql`。 4. **创建必要的目录**: 进入`/usr/local/mysql`目录,创建`data`文件夹用于存储MySQL的数据。接下来,创建用户和用户组,如`groupadd mysql`和`useradd -r -g mysql mysql`,以便后续管理。 5. **设置权限**: 对刚创建的用户和数据文件夹进行权限调整,使用`chown-R`命令分别赋予`mysql`用户和用户组读写权限。 6. **初始化数据库**: 执行`b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data`命令,初始化数据库。此时系统会自动生成一个随机密码,需记录下来以供后续登录使用。 7. **修改MySQL目录权限**: 将`/usr/local/mysql`目录的所有者和所有群组更改为`root:root`,然后将`data`目录的权限更改为`mysql:mysql`,确保数据库的完整性和安全性。 8. **配置my.cnf文件**: 在`/usr/local/mysql/support-files`目录下创建一个名为`my-default.cnf`的文件,设置必要的配置选项。然后将此文件复制到`/etc`目录下,重命名为`my.cnf`,以供MySQL服务启动时使用。 通过以上步骤,您已经成功地在Linux系统上安装并配置了MySQL 8.0.18。在实际操作过程中,务必根据系统的实际情况和需求进行调整,确保每个步骤的正确执行。